10,000 Free Tickets for Global Citizen Festival India will be announced next week

The first draw of free tickets for the 2016 Global Citizen Festival India will open for entry on Sunday 18 September on www.globalcitizen.in. A total of 10,000 free tickets are available in the first ever Action Journey ticket draw. Each person who has signed up as a Global Citizen on www.globalcitizen.in and completed actions in their Action Journey for social change must earn a minimum of 16 points to be eligible for the draw. Global Citizen’s will be able to enter this ticket draw until Thursday, 22 September.

On Sunday 18 September, registered Global Citizens with 16 points or more will see a red entry button appear on their accounts. They will be able to click this button to trade in their points for the chance to win 2 tickets to the much-anticipated Global Citizen Festival India. After the draw is run on 22 September, winners will be notified within 72 hours.

Several thousand Free Tickets will be released over the coming weeks through five different ticket draws at the end of each Action Journey.

The Global Citizen Festival India will leverage the voices of Global Citizens to influence world leaders and decision makers to enact policy changes and commit significant resources to help solve some of the world’s biggest challenges. The inaugural Festival will be held in Mumbai on 19 November 2016, and will be headlined by Coldplay, Jay Z, Aamir Khan, A.R. Rahman, Ranveer Singh, Katrina Kaif, Farhan Akhtar, Shraddha Kapoor, Arjun Kapoor, Arijit Singh, Dia Mirza, Shankar Ehsaan Loy, and Monali Thakur. Several major artists and international guests will be announced at different stages of the campaign.

Farhan Akhtar said that taking collective action was vital to achieve the Global Goals and end extreme poverty: "Global Citizen India is doing something unique. It is offering us a platform wherein our individual efforts and voices can combine together to push for collective action. Offering the Global Goals as a roadmap not only encourages collective action within a country, but also across the world, and it is this collective, merged action that can truly make a difference."

Eighty percent of the tickets to the festival will be given out to Global Citizens who earn them by taking action.
